Lexicon :: Strong's H4147 - môsēr

Aa
מוֹסֵר
Transliteration
môsēr
Pronunciation
mo-sare'
Listen
Part of Speech
masculine noun
Root Word (Etymology)
Dictionary Aids

TWOT Reference: 141f

Strong’s Definitions

מוֹסֵר môwçêr, mo-sare'; also (in plural) feminine מוֹסֵרָה môwçêrâh; or מֹסְרָה môçᵉrâh; from H3256; properly, chastisement, i.e. (by implication) a halter; figuratively, restraint:—band, bond.


KJV Translation Count — Total: 11x

The KJV translates Strong's H4147 in the following manner: bands (6x), bond (5x).

STRONGS H4147: Abbreviations
† [מוֺסֵר] noun masculineIsaiah 28:22 band, bond, in poetry & late (= מֹאסֵר; Ethiopic bdb006405Syriac bdb006406, compare Assyrian mêsiru, sheathing, plating, e.g. LyonSargontexte, p. 16, l. 65 & p. 80) — construct מוֺסַר Job 12:18 (so Di Hoffm and others for מוּסַר); plural מוֺסֵרוֺת Jeremiah 5:5; Jeremiah 27:2; construct מֹסְרוֺת Job 39:5; מוֺסְרֵי Isaiah 52:2; suffix מוֺסֵרָי֑ Psalm 116:16; מוֺסְרוֺתֶיךָ Jeremiah 30:8; מוֺסְרֵיכֶם Isaiah 28:22; מוֺסְרוֺתֵי֑מוֺ Psalm 2:3 etc.; — bands accusative after פִתֵּהַ Job 39:5 restraining-bands of wild ass; Psalm 116:16 bonds of distress; Isaiah 52:2 צַוָּארֵח מ׳ bonds of captivity of Zion, verb Hithp.; compare also Job 12:18 מוֺסַר מְלָכִים פִּתֵּחַ (so read, see above & AV RV); Di understands bonds imposed by kings; Hoffm girdles of kings, & reads וַיָּסַר in ||, for וַיֶּאְסַר; more often accusative after נִתֵּק Psalm 2:3 bonds imposed by י׳ & his anointed, compare Jeremiah 5:5 & Jeremiah 2:20 (Greek Version of the LXX Vulgate, see Commentaries); of Yahweh's breaking bonds of Israel Jeremiah 30:8; Nahum 1:13 (last four || שָׁבַר עֹל), bonds of oppressed Psalm 107:14; יֶחְזְקוּ מ׳ Isaiah 28:22, i.e. bonds imposed by Assyria; compare Jeremiah 27:2 (|| מֹט) literal, symbolic of rule of Nebuchadrezzar.
Brown-Driver-Briggs Hebrew and English Lexicon, Unabridged, Electronic Database.
